A keypad is worth ten apps.
Apps are fine. Keypads are better. A clean, labeled keypad in the right location — next to the bed, at the top of the stairs, in the primary suite — is the shortest distance between a person and the light they want.
We program scenes room by room with the homeowner: "Morning," "Evening," "Dinner," "Reading," "All Off." Each one dims fixtures, tunes color temperature, and cues shades — in one motion.

Lutron, Crestron, or Savant for lighting — does it matter which?
Yes. Lutron HomeWorks is the default for any home above roughly 30 keypads — it's the most mature, the most reliable, and offered as a Lutron Certified system with documented commissioning. Crestron Zum and Savant lighting are excellent when the rest of the system already lives on those platforms. We rarely mix lighting and AV control on different brands without a clear reason.
What is tunable white lighting, and is it worth the cost?
Tunable white lets a single fixture shift from warm 2200K candlelight to cool 5000K daylight on a schedule. For the primary living spaces, primary suite, and kitchen, it's transformative — mornings feel awake, evenings feel calm. For closets, garage, and utility rooms, dimmable warm white is enough. We map it room by room during design.
How do motorized shades stay quiet and synchronized?
We specify Lutron QS or Sivoia shades with DC battery or hardwired motors — the quietest in the industry, around 36 dB. Synchronization is handled by the lighting system, not the shades themselves: every shade in a row receives the same command at the same instant, so they move together without the visible cascade you see on cheaper systems.
Can shades and lighting follow the sun automatically?
Yes — that's a core part of the design. Astronomical timing built into Lutron HomeWorks tracks sunrise and sunset for your exact address. Shades drop at solar noon on south-facing rooms to protect art and floors. Lights warm in the evening. The household adjusts to it within a week and never goes back.
Do tall windows and unusual shapes work with motorized shades?
Almost always. We've installed shades on 18'+ windows, angled clerestories, curved bays, and skylights. The constraints are fabric weight, motor torque, and pocket depth — all resolvable in design if we're brought in before the framing is closed. After the fact, options narrow.
Will the lighting still work if the smart home control system fails?
Yes. Lutron keypads communicate directly with Lutron processors over a dedicated wired bus, independent of the AV control system. Even if Crestron, Savant, or the home network is fully down, every keypad still controls its lights. Scenes triggered from the AV app fail back gracefully to manual keypad control.

What is circadian lighting?
Circadian lighting uses tunable-white or full-spectrum fixtures that shift color temperature across the day — cooler and brighter in the morning, warmer and dimmer in the evening — to support natural sleep and wake cycles. Ketra and Lutron Homeworks with tunable-white fixtures deliver this out of the box.
How do you handle Hill Country west-facing solar load?
Central Texas homes get astronomical shade schedules that close west-facing zones through the hottest hours of the day and open them back up at sunset, cutting cooling load without you touching a thing. Deep-summer scenes daytime-blackout rooms that would otherwise cook.
Can outdoor and landscape lighting be integrated?
Yes. Landscape and outdoor architectural lighting integrates with the same Lutron system as interior fixtures, so path lights, tree uplights, and pool lighting all follow the same scene structure as the rest of the house.
Are Lutron Sivoia motors really quiet?
Yes — Sivoia QS motors are among the quietest available, designed to be inaudible from across the room in normally furnished spaces. We align hem bars to millwork and cove details so light gaps read intentional, not sloppy.
